PennDOT Learner’s Permit Test in Yiddish 2026 NEW RULES. Confident drivers tend to assume outcomes. They assume other drivers will stop when required, that pedestrians will act predictably, and that traffic will flow as expected.
This mindset works in everyday driving most of the time, but it fails inside the exam. PennDOT questions are written from the perspective that things go wrong. The correct answer is usually the one that prepares for mistakes, not the one that assumes cooperation.
